Ireland Joins e-FX Race As Ulster Bank Readies System

INTERNET

DUBLIN--Ulster Bank is set to launch Ireland’s first web-based forex trading service for corporate clients next month.

The system--called TraderGold--will be rolled out to customers in three phases over the course of this year. The final stage will be rolled out before the end of 2000.
